Cannot find NT Oracle server DLL
Hello,
I am trying to install SAP BusinessObjects Data Services 4.1 SP2 in Windows 7.
Data Repository is 64-bit Oracle database.
PATH to oracle: C:\Oracle\product\11.2.0\c lient_1\bi n;
I get an error below when I tried to connect using Data services designer.
"Cannot find NT Oracle server DLL (OCI.DLL). ensure that oracle is installed and the PATH variable points to correct lib directories"
Please assist. OCI.DLL file is found in the path mentioned above. I am not sure what is missing.

If SAP BusinessObjects Data Services 4.1 is a 32Bit app, you need the 32Bit Oracle client and drivers installed.
